| K.J. Somaiya Institute
of Management Studies and Research Set up in 1981, the K.J. Somaiya Institute of Management Studies and Research Studies (SIMSR) started with the two year Diploma in Management Studies (DMS) course of the University of Bombay. It was inaugurated by the then Governor of the Reserve Bank of India, and former Union Finance Minister, Dr. Manmohan Singh. SIMSR has subsequently produced over six hundred managers occupying responsible positions in the corporate world.
SIMSR lies nestled in a vast 60 acre campus providing the right setting for imparting education. The campus is located in the north-east suburb of Bombay and is well connected by road and rail. The institutions housed in the campus support a student population of over 17,000.
The Institute offers the following two years full time courses: Masters in Management studies (M.M.S) - affiliated to the University of Bombay Post Graduate Programme in Management Studies (PGPMS) - Autonomous Masters in Computer Software Applications (M.C.S.A.) - Autonomous
The Institute also offers the following part time courses for the working executives. Classes for these courses are held in the evenings.
